OpenStride MCP Server
Model Context Protocol (MCP) server that allows AI assistants (Claude, ChatGPT, etc.) to access and analyze your OpenStride training data.

Claude Desktop
Add to your Claude Desktop config (~/.config/Claude/claude_desktop_config.json on Linux/macOS or %APPDATA%\Claude\claude_desktop_config.json on Windows):
{
"mcpServers": {
"openstride": {
"command": "npx",
"args": ["-y", "@openstride/mcp-server"],
"env": {
"OPENSTRIDE_MANIFEST_URL": "https://drive.google.com/uc?id=YOUR_MANIFEST_ID"
}
}
}
}Getting Your Manifest URL
- Open OpenStride
- Go to Profile > App Extensions
- Enable AI Assistant (MCP)
- Go to Profile > AI Assistant (MCP)
- Connect Google Drive (if not already connected)
- Click Publish Data
- Copy the manifest URL
Available Tools
list_activities
List activities with filters and pagination.
Parameters:
limit(number): Max results (default: 20, max: 100)offset(number): Pagination offsettype(string[]): Activity types (run,bike,swim,walk,hike)startDate(string): Start date (YYYY-MM-DD)endDate(string): End date (YYYY-MM-DD)minDistance(number): Min distance in metersmaxDistance(number): Max distance in meters
get_activity
Get complete activity details.
Parameters:
activityId(string): Activity ID
get_stats
Calculate aggregated statistics.
Parameters:
period(string): Aggregation period (week,month,year)startDate(string): Start dateendDate(string): End date
search_activities
Search activities by text.
Parameters:
query(string): Search query (title, notes)
analyze_activity
Analyze activity performance.
Parameters:
activityId(string): Activity IDanalyses(string[]): Analysis types (segments,best-efforts,slope,heart-rate-zones)
Requirements
- Google Drive connection in OpenStride
- Activities marked as public (privacy settings)
